Networking is a key skill for studying and starting a career. Many students are
unsure how to establish contacts, present themselves convincingly and maintain relationships
in the long term, especially if they have little professional experience or if there are hierarchical
differences. Using digital platforms such as LinkedIn to network
is also a challenge for many.
This seminar teaches students in a practical way how to organise networking as authentic relationship
building based on an honest interest in the other person. Students learn how
they can develop genuine, sustainable professional networks step by step, present themselves confidently and consciously utilise
networking opportunities.
Contents of the seminar:
- The basics of networking: importance, goals and opportunities
- Authentic appearance: utilising your own strengths to establish genuine contacts
- Communication strategies: Initiating conversations, actively listening and organising follow-ups
- Online and offline networking: using platforms, events and functions effectively
